RTX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

1,882 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in RTX Corp (RTX)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$91B — up 22% from $74.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 157 funds opened new RTX positions and 126 closed out — a net gain of 31 holders — while 765 added to existing stakes and 744 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Third Point, opening a new position worth an estimated $782M. The largest seller was UBS Group, cutting an estimated $403M.
